Impediment (Noun)

Meaning 1

Something immaterial that interferes with or delays action or progress.

Classification

Nouns denoting cognitive processes and contents.

Examples

  • Lack of funding was a significant impediment to the project's completion.
  • The bureaucratic red tape was a major impediment to the implementation of the new policy.
  • Her fear of failure was a psychological impediment to pursuing her dreams.
  • The language barrier proved to be an impediment to communication between the two teams.
  • The company's outdated technology was an impediment to innovation and growth.
